plan b (D/GB)
Fortysomething

Imagine that city could record the thoughts and memories of the people who live there. So as you walk around the streets and squares of Graz, you could start to hear voices talking about the artwork that was and still is around you, artwork from the forty years of the steirischer herbst. Fortysomething is a project that makes this possible.

To celebrate the forty-year anniversary of steirischer herbst, plan b will create a GPS-triggered audio guide that charts, investigates and reveals the events that have taken place on the streets of the city during the festival. Public art, sculpture, happenings, performances and concerts will all be commemorated in the places they happened through the voices of those who were there.
